  • Abstract
    The primary goal of this research is to improve the robustness of tone models and tone recognition rate in continuous Mandarin speech. The procedure was as follows: firstly, four lexical tone models, which are used in isolated Mandarin speech, are employed in clustering tones of continuous Mandarin speech. Then, for reference tone data, variable tone patterns are predicted by using context information. Thirdly, tone dictionary is obtained as combinations of all prediction patterns for tone recognition. The studies we carried out demonstrated that the proposed method outperforms the traditional method with 20 context-dependent tone models and that with eight left-context-dependent tone models for tone recognition.
